Remove unused symbol constants

These were only used by IO predicates removed earlier
by commit d56882fa79df9e9b47a1906b2a3662fe6d0727b5.

Change-Id: I39b051d0fb744a5c1bd3122eea0f26961efa8531
diff --git a/src/lang/Prolog.java b/src/lang/Prolog.java
index d64412f..25ced4e 100644
--- a/src/lang/Prolog.java
+++ b/src/lang/Prolog.java
@@ -89,16 +89,6 @@
     /** Holds an atom <code>[]<code> (empty list). */
     public static final SymbolTerm Nil     = SymbolTerm.intern("[]");
 
-    /* Some symbols for stream options */
-    static final SymbolTerm SYM_MODE_1     = SymbolTerm.intern("mode", 1);
-    static final SymbolTerm SYM_ALIAS_1    = SymbolTerm.intern("alias", 1);
-    static final SymbolTerm SYM_TYPE_1     = SymbolTerm.intern("type", 1);
-    static final SymbolTerm SYM_READ       = SymbolTerm.intern("read");
-    static final SymbolTerm SYM_APPEND     = SymbolTerm.intern("append");
-    static final SymbolTerm SYM_INPUT      = SymbolTerm.intern("input");
-    static final SymbolTerm SYM_OUTPUT     = SymbolTerm.intern("output");
-    static final SymbolTerm SYM_TEXT       = SymbolTerm.intern("text");
-
     public static enum Feature {
       /** Access to the local filesystem and console. */
       IO,